We're looking for an Indirect Tax Manager to be part of the in-house tax team at Virgin Atlantic. This role will support the Group's permanent Indirect Tax Manager whilst they play a key role in the implementation of our new ERP system.

This role has responsibility for managing indirect tax compliance processes and will work closely with the Senior Tax Manager to ensure Global indirect tax compliance is maintained. You will have responsibility for delivering technical advice and compliance support to the Virgin Atlantic Group, whilst managing risk and controls on a day-to-day basis to ensure the Group's UK and overseas indirect tax compliance requirements are met. The role requires working closely with Working Capital, Financial Accounting, Procurement, Legal and the wider business to ensure an appropriate tax control framework is maintained.

Day to day

Some of your key responsibilities as our Indirect Tax Manager will be: 
  • Managing the UK VAT compliance process and controls, including timely and thorough technical review of the monthly return process ready for sign off by senior management. Reviewing and approving VAT treatment of new income streams, transactions and contracts. Providing advice on business activity and projects to internal business functions as required to ensure projects are delivered compliantly and tax efficiently.
  • Supporting with Customs Duty compliance and ensuring the business meets its reporting obligations under AEO, End Use, CFSP, Airworthiness and other reliefs. Activities will include auditing work undertaken by Customs Agents and working closely with the wider business to ensure appropriate controls and processes are maintained.
  • Management of the APD reporting process, including provision of technical advice, review of monthly returns, periodic audits and providing advice to the business on enhancing systems configuration.
  • Working closely with the Indirect Tax Manager to maintain an appropriate tax control framework and manage indirect tax risk to an appropriate level. This will involve reviewing, testing and documenting processes to identify areas where controls and integrity can be enhanced and ensuring the group has appropriate accounting arrangements.
  • Responsibility for overseeing world-wide indirect tax compliance processes such as VAT, GST and Sales and Use returns and mitigating tax risks through effective communication with overseas offices.
  • Identifying opportunities to optimise the group's cash position through tax initiatives, timely compliance and appropriate planning.
  • Managing external advisors, scoping advice and negotiating fees. Sourcing and managing the delivery of external advice, ensuring advice is implemented correctly and projects are seen through to completion.
  • Proactively monitoring changes in legislation and identifying the need for in-depth projects to support business and compliance requirements.
  • Identifying the need for and delivering training to stakeholder departments to ensure relevant knowledge and awareness of tax sensitive issues.
  • Supporting the Indirect Tax Manager and Head of Tax with correspondence to HMRC/Overseas Tax Authorities including VAT group registrations, clearance applications, AEO compliance, technical positioning papers, ECNs, audits, quarterly calls and annual BRR meetings.

  • We're looking for an experienced specialist with practical experience of managing compliance processes. Ideally you will have CTA or equivalent and years of experience providing and implementing technical advice.
  • The ideal candidate will be comfortable working in a fast-paced environment and have an established and broad experience of VAT issues, including reverse charges, financing transactions, supplies of aircraft and passenger transport, TOMS, Partial Exemption, Customs and Excise taxes, cross border transactions, US Sales and Use taxes and AEO compliance, combined with the confidence to correspond effectively with HMRC and other stakeholders. It is advantageous if you have had exposure to APD and Stamp Taxes.
  • You will need to possess excellent communication skills to work cross functionally with senior management, influence business decisions, have the ability to analyse complex and diverse documents, make appropriate evaluations and recommendations, and have the technical skills to be the subject lead on projects.
